The Janitorial Supplies and Equipment Provision subcontract involves the delivery of cleaning chemicals, tools, and equipment to prime contractors working on Alabama Department of Public Health facility projects. The scope of work includes providing medical-grade high-coefficient disinfectants, industrial vacuums, mops, and color-coded microfiber cleaning systems, all of which must strictly adhere to ADPH standards for health facility sanitation. This opportunity is categorized under NAICS code 423440 and is associated with the state of Alabama. The posting was made on September 3, 2026, with a response deadline of September 17, 2026. The contract ensures that all approved cleaning agents and hardware are delivered directly to the designated facilities to maintain required sanitary conditions.
